What You’ll Do
- Inspect Incoming Materials to verify plastics, metals, fasteners, and electronic components meet engineering specifications.
- Perform In‑Process Inspections during fabrication, assembly, finishing, and packaging stages.
- Conduct Final Product Audits on accessories such as interior trim, racks, running boards, lighting components, and interior/exterior add‑ons.
- Use Precision Measurement Tools including calipers, micrometers, gauges, and CMM equipment.
- Identify and Document Defects and communicate findings to production and engineering teams.
- Support Root Cause Analysis and corrective action initiatives.
- Maintain Accurate Quality Records for traceability and audits.
- Ensure Compliance with internal and customer‑specific requirements.
- Promote Safety and 5S Standards in all inspection areas.
What You Bring
- Experience in automotive, manufacturing, or quality inspection
- Ability to read blueprints, engineering drawings, and work instructions
- Strong attention to detail and problem‑solving skills
- Comfortable using measurement tools and documenting results
- Ability to stand for long periods and lift 35–50 lbs as needed
